Transaction 8e3cc2118c4f974e52e246d17fd42b0487d8296a5e3ce681472efb8a444dc85e

block
24551365f35b8a672fe1f9c7cec7761c3b428df55e4593789d9e34b303c0cfb2

1 Input

115 Outputs